British Tax Review: 2001 Bound Volume
Providing an analysis across the whole field of tax law, this work includes articles that cover domestic, international and comparative topics. The articles examine topics such as the IMF and tax reform, the new Australia-UK tax treaty, and implications of the O'Donnell Review on UK tax policy.

Current Notes - offering concise comment on topical matters such as draft legislation and consultative documents. Articles providing an in-depth look at specialist topics. Case notes - significant case law with critical comment. Book reviews and notices.
